How hard is superstar Killington?

“It becomes more challenging with other skiers,” he says. “You have to watch out for them as well as yourself.” Locals rave about doing laps with a quick Superstar Express Quad ride up and then down. Superstar is 4,600 to 4,800 feet long, has a 1,200-foot vertical drop and 30- to 50-degree pitch.

What is the hardest run at Killington?

At the main Killington peak, Ovation, especially the lower third past the headwall, is another great steep along with Cascade, which has the steepest fall line from Killington peak to the K-1 base area. Downdraft, Flume, Escapade, Double Dipper and East Fall are the other steeps in the K-1/Canyon area.

How late can you ski Killington?

Best time to visit Killington Ski Resort Killington’s season can start as early as mid-October and last all the way to June 1, though in general, the resort opens in early November and closes mid-May.

Is Killington hard to ski?

Featuring six distinct mountain peaks, each with its own personality, Killington definitely lives up to its moniker. And with 140 trails serviced by 22 lifts that traverse 70-miles of terrain, that Beast can be tough for first timers to navigate.

Is there night skiing at Killington?

There is no night skiing at Killington, however there is a tubing park, snowmobiling tours, snowshoe tours, ski bike rentals and “The Beast” mountain coaster.

Does Killington have a village?

Regardless of the time, effort, and millions of dollars expended, Killington still does not have a village with ample slopeside housing and a village center, which would impart a “sense of place.” It is a conundrum that defies logic and the “experts” as well as many local and regional residents.

What is the biggest ski mountain in Vermont?

Killington Ski Resort
Killington Ski Resort The biggest ski resort in Vermont (and all of the eastern U.S.), Killington also has New England’s largest vertical drop: 3,050 feet. Predictably the first resort in the region to open for the season, Killington prides itself on offering the longest skiing and snowboarding season in the East.

What is the longest run at Killington?

Juggernaut trail
Longest Ski Run in The Eastern US: Killington, Vermont The 6.5 mile long Juggernaut trail at Killington claims the ‘longest in Eastern US’ title in terms of length.

Does Killington have a superpipe?

Superpipe is Killington’s giant half pipe at the base of the Bear Mountain base area. To access this location, either take the Skyeship Gondola Stage II out of the Needle’s Eye area, or the Skye Peak Express Quad out of Bear Mountain (which is the best choice).
